logo

Output 623b4303956bdbbca2d66468e91c308f81f065bb97179a1ea9154274f5b79665:0

value
7000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21f9392aa60a324c57eb7aed26b95a075392b60e OP_EQUALVERIFY OP_CHECKSIG
address
146drfphSLbmUVbNwnga2VPGDmUSjfVbGV
transaction
623b4303956bdbbca2d66468e91c308f81f065bb97179a1ea9154274f5b79665